#1731f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1731f2 is composed of 9% red, 19.2%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.5% cyan, 79.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 232.9 degrees, a saturation of 89.4% and a lightness of 52%. #1731f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#2e62ff with #0000e5. Closest websafe color is: #0033ff.

Shades and Tints of #1731f2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010209 is the darkest color, while #f6f7fe is the lightest one.
